Mills is a man who was a part of a group of random people selected sacrificed to bring an eldritch monster into reality. They picked people who didn't have family or people who upon observation were judged as easily forgotten.
Instead thanks to outside influences, an annoying dick named Kenneth (who lives in Mills' head now), and his own spite ended up devouring the eldritch being's heart instead. Inheriting the title of 'Eldritch Lord of ancient flesh', and a pocket dimension made entirely of meat an bone.
This wasn't really something he set out intending to do, infact he hates everything about it. Yet the reason he was even capable of handling something like that is largely due to his own choices and mistakes. If he hadn't have stepped up the world would have basically been doomed. So he's saddled with power he never wanted, when he'd really rather just be at home watching old action and kaiju movies.
With his options basically being locked away, attempting to take over the world, or become a monster hunter he landed on the monster hunter path. He's got a truck load of guilt, and that route was the only one that would stop other people ending up like he has.
Now he struggles to maintain his sanity when faced with what he is, and how no matter how hard he tries to fight it he'll never really be human again.
